The Fortunate Ones delivers a gritty blend of drama and horror, capturing the raw tension of a world in chaos. Matt, the central character, embodies desperation, and his emotional turmoil is palpable throughout. The pacing is deliberate, letting the viewer soak in the eerie atmosphere of desolation as he navigates his struggle. The practical effects are commendable, with a haunting portrayal of the undead that feels unsettlingly real. Performances, especially from the lead, ground the film in a poignant sense of loss, adding layers to the horror. The deserted cottage serves not just as a setting but as a symbol of hope lost, making it a distinctive entry in the genre that lingers in the mind.
